Information About Rifle Glass

Rifle scopes enable you to exactly align a rifle at different targets by lining up your eye with the target at range. They do this through zoom using a series of lenses within the scope. The scope’s positioning can be adapted to take into account various ecological considerations like wind and elevation decreases to account for bullet drop.

The scope’s function is to help shooters understand precisely where the bullet will hit based on the sight picture you are seeing using the optic as you align the scope’s crosshair or reticle with the intended point of impact. Many contemporary rifle scopes and optics have about 11 parts which are located inside and on the exterior of the scope body. These scope parts consist of the rifle scope’s body, lenses, elevation dials or turrets, objective focus rings, and other elements. Learn about the eleven parts of optics.

Rifle Glass Types

Rifle scopes can be either “first focal plane” or “second focal plane” kind of scopes. The type of focal plane a scope has decides where the reticle or crosshair lies relative to the scopes zoom. It simply implies the reticle is behind or before the magnification lens of the scope. Selecting the most beneficial sort of rifle scope is dependent on what variety of shooting you anticipate doing.

First Focal Plane Optic Facts

Focal plane scopes (FFP) feature the reticle in front of the magnifying lens. This causes the reticle to increase in size based upon the amount of zoom being used. The benefit is that the reticle measurements are the same at the magnified distance as they are at the non magnified distance. One tick on a mil-dot reticle at 100 yards without “zoom” is still the exact same tick at 100 yards with 5x “zoom”. These kinds of scopes are useful for:

  • Quick acquisition, far away kinds of shooting
  • Shooting circumstances where estimations are very little
  • Experienced shooters who know their aim point “hold over” as well as “lead” equations for their weapon
  • Shooters who don’t mind the reticle is enlarged and uses up more visual eyesight space than a SFP reticle

Second Focal Plane Optic Info

Second focal plane optics (SFP) come with the reticle behind the magnifying lens. This triggers the reticle to remain at the exact same scale in connection with the quantity of magnification being used. The final result is that the reticle measurements shift based upon the zoom chosen to shoot over greater ranges given that the reticle markings represent distinct increments which vary with the zoom. In the FFP example with the SFP scope, the 5x “zoom” one hundred yard tick would be 1/5th of the non “zoom” tick measurement. These particular sorts of glass are beneficial for:

  • Far away styles of shooting where shooters have increased time to make ballistic calculations
  • Shooting where most shots occur within much shorter ranges and distances
  • Shooters who would like a clearer optic sight picture with less room used up by the enlarged FFP reticle

About Rifle Optic Magnification

The amount of zoom a scope supplies is figured out by the diameter, thickness, and curvatures of the lenses inside of the rifle scope. The zoom of the scope is the “power” of the scope.

Single Power Lens Rifle Optic Facts

A single power rifle optic or scope will have a zoom number designator like 4×32. This means the magnification power of the scope is 4x power while the objective lens is 32mm. The zoom of this kind of scope can not adjust since it is a fixed power scope.

Variable Power Lens Rifle Scope Details

Variable power rifle scopes use enhanced power. The power adjustment is handled by using the power ring part of the scope near the back of the scope by the eye bell.

Rifle Glass Lens Finish

All contemporary rifle optic and scope lenses are layered. There are different types and qualities of glass lens coatings. Lens finishing is a crucial aspect of a rifle’s setup when looking into high-end rifle optics and targeting equipment. The glass lenses are among the most essential pieces of the scope because they are what your eye sees through while sighting a rifle in on the point of impact. The covering on the lenses shields the lens surface and helps with anti glare capabilities from excess light and color presence.

Info on Rifle Scope Lens Coatings – HD Versus ED

Some scope brands also use “HD” or high-definition lens coverings which use various techniques, polarizations, chemicals, and elements to draw out a wide range of colors and viewable quality through the lens. Some scope manufacturers use “HD” to refer to “ED” to signify the lens has extra-low dispersion glass.

Single Glass Lens Finish Versus Multi-Coating

Different optic lenses can even have different finishings applied to them. All lenses normally have at least some kind of treatment or finish applied to them before they are used in a rifle scope or optic assembly. This is since the lens isn’t simply a raw piece of glass. It becomes part of the carefully tuned optic. It requires a coating to be applied to it so that the lens will be optimally usable in many types of environments, degrees of light (full VS shaded), and other shooting conditions.

This lens treatment can safeguard the lens from scratches while reducing glare and other less helpful things experienced in the shooting environment while sighting in with the scope. The quality of a single coated lens depends on the scope maker and how much you paid for it.

Some scope producers also make it a point to define if their optic lenses are coated or “multi” covered. Being “better” depends on the manufacturer’s lens treatment innovation and the quality of products used in developing the rifle scope.

Anti-water Finish for Optics

Water on a lens doesn’t assist with keeping a clear sight picture through a scope at all. Many top of the line and military grade scope companies will coat their lenses with a hydrophobic or hydrophilic finish.

Choices for Mounting Rifle Scopes on Long Guns

Installing solutions for scopes come in a couple of options. There are the basic scope rings which are individually mounted to the scope and one-piece scope mounts which cradle the scope. These different kinds of mounts also typically are made in quick release versions which use toss levers which permit rifle operators to quickly install and dismount the optics.

Hex Key Rifle Scope Ring Mounting Solutions

Basic, clamp style mounting optic rings use hex head screws to install to the flattop design Picatinny scope mounting rails on the tops of rifles. These varieties of scope mounts use two detached rings to support the optic, and are made from 7075 T6 billet aluminum or similar materials which are manufactured for long distance precision shooting. This form of scope mount is great for rifles which require a resilient, unfailing mount which will not change regardless of how much the scope is moved or jarring the rifle takes. These are the type of mounts you really want to have for a faithful optics setup on a reach out and touch someone scouting or competition long gun that will almost never need to be modified or adjusted. Blue 242 Loctite threadlocker can additionally be used on the mount’s screws to stop the hex screw threads from wiggling out after they are mounted tightly in position. An example of these rings are the 30mm type from the Vortex Optics company. The set typically costs around $200 USD

Rifle Optic Mounting Solutions with Quick-Release Cantilever Rings

These types of quick-release rifle scope mounts can be used to quickly attach and take off a scope from a rifle before reattaching it to a different rifle. Numerous scopes can also be swapped out if they all use a similar design mount. These types of mounts are handy for rifles which are transported a lot, to remove the optic from the rifle for protecting the scope, or for optics which are used in between several rifles or are situationally focused.

About Optic Tube Sealing and Gas Purging

Wetness inside your rifle scope can mess up a day of shooting and your pricey optic by bringing about fogging and producing residue inside of the scope tube. Many scopes prevent wetness from going into the scope tube with a system of sealing O-rings which are waterproof.

Gas Purged Scope Tubes

Another component of preventing the buildup of moisture within the rifle scope tube is filling the tube with a gas like nitrogen. Given that this area is already occupied by the gas, the optic is less influenced by temperature level alterations and pressure differences from the outside environment which may possibly allow water vapor to permeate in around the seals to fill the vacuum which would otherwise be there. These are good qualities of a good rifle scope to seek out.
